Girlfriends Run for a Cure
Girlfriends Run is a women-focused running and walking event held at Vancouver Waterfront Park on October 18, 2026. The event offers multiple distances:
- Half Marathon
- 10K
- 6K
The event benefits the Pink Lemonade Project; the organizer notes that the charity relies on direct donations rather than registration fees. Race-day perks described by the organizer include women’s technical shirts, finisher medals or necklaces, post-race refreshments such as mimosas and pastries, pampering stations, massage, and other finish-area amenities.
Packet pickup is provided at a local running store and on race morning at the waterfront location. Participants must show identification to collect packets and may pick up a packet for another person only with a signed authorization form and a copy of that person’s ID. A bag check is available at the registration booth; bib numbers should be marked on bags and shown when reclaiming items.
Awards are presented for top overall and masters finishers, plus age-group awards for women across many age brackets. Walkers are not eligible for competitive awards, and participants choosing the Athena category are not eligible for age-group prizes. The organizer lists official course records with times by year.
Course notes and policies include a high number of portable toilets at start and along the route, bathroom access at Warehouse 23, guidance on jogging strollers starting at the back due to narrow out-and-back sections, a one-earbud music policy for safety, and a limit of service dogs only on course.
